| Form 990 Part VI | 12c | As each new board member is recruited, they are given a copy of the Conflict of Interest Policy. During orientation for new board members, an explanation of the Conflict of Interest Policy and Disclosure form is presented. Every year, the Organization requires every board member and key employee to fill out a Conflict of Interest Disclosure Form. The board President follows up with each board member to ensure that they do. Each board members and key employees form is kept on file in the Organizations office. During board and committee meetings, board members and key employees are asked to recuse themselves from any vote that may present a conflict of interest and such recusal is recorded in the minutes. |
